Dec 3, 4 pm: Young Strings Workshop at the Perrot Library.
Darwin Shen, professional violinist and conductor of the Young Artists Philharmonic Strings Ensemble, will lead a workshop to help young strings students become confident strings players. The workshop will review basic skills such as how to tune your instrument, how to take care of your instrument, how to hold and rosin your bow, plus tips on practicing. For grades 4 to 8, limited to 20. To register, please call the Youth Services at the Perrot at 203-637-8802.

JOURNALISTS VISIT 5TH GRADE
On Monday, Jo Kroeker, a reporter for the Greenwich Time met with the fifth graders to help kick off their journalism unit. Jo talked to the students about writing stories for the newspaper, the difference between a breaking news story and a feature, and walked them through the process of researching and writing an article. Jo used the recent example of the context for our new school mascot to walk students through how to build a story. You might even see a story about the Riverside Red Hawk in the Greenwich Time soon! This program was organized by the PTA Arts Enrichment Committee.

TREX CHALLENGE!
Did you know that plastic bags, wraps and film are not accepted in your recycling bin at home? These items CAN however be recycled at participating grocery stores and now conveniently at Riverside! Riverside will be competing in the TREX "Plastic Film Collection" Challenge against other elementary schools in the Northeast. The challenge kicks off on America Recycles Day (November 15) and winners are announced on Earth Day (April 22).
We are collecting
clean and dry produce, newspaper and dry cleaning bags, case and bubble wrap and other accepted items in the collection bin at the entrance of school and
will encourage students to recycle these items in the cafeteria too!
Each month, the plastic collected will be weighed and recorded, and then sent to Trex to become composite decking. See the PTA Green Schools site for a list of accepted materials and Trex challenge details.
Please help the environment and Riverside School by dropping off your plastic bags and film!
